Glossary of interventions 90 References 94 4 Behaviour Change for Antibiotic Prescribing Executive summary The Annual Report of the Chief Medical Officer published in March 2013 highlighted the threat posed by Antibiotic resistance to the UK.
6 This report is part of the response to that call to action. It proposes new and enhanced interventions that have the potential to reduce the risk of Antibiotic resistance. These interventions are grounded in behavioural science, underpinned by a thorough review of the evidence, and have robust theoretical foundations for their mechanism of action. We undertook a literature search to identify more than 150 scientific articles to review. Few of them took a behavioural science approach. From these we assessed the available evidence about key behaviours that support Antibiotic stewardship across three important constituencies: the public and patients; primary care; and secondary care.
7 We subsequently carried out a behavioural analysis using the theoretical domains framework17 and COM-B18 model. The theoretical domains framework distils a range of Behaviour Change theories into domains explaining common influences on Behaviour . COM-B is an associated model of Behaviour . These analyses identified the key behaviours and, importantly, drivers for those behaviours that may be amenable to Change . From this we were able to identify a series of potential new or enhanced interventions that may mitigate Antibiotic resistance. We are sharing this behavioural analysis for two reasons.

9 Others are also encouraged to use these strategically-identified opportunities to contribute to the fight against antimicrobial resistance. behaviours that drive Antibiotic resistance Primary care: about four-fifths of antibiotics are prescribed in primary care. There are substantial barriers to improving antimicrobial stewardship in this setting. There is considerable local variation in Prescribing rates that is not explained by case-mix and may be attributed to behavioural factors. Many primary care prescribers admit that even some of their own Prescribing will not be clinically beneficial.
10 This is because it is the norm, because they fear 5 Behaviour Change for Antibiotic Prescribing what might happen should they withhold antibiotics, and because they perceive that their patients will be dissatisfied. Patient Behaviour : public understanding is mixed. Misconceptions include that resistance will only affect patients who over-consume antibiotics. Considerable efforts in educating the public have been made, but with varying degrees of success. Patient pressure for antibiotics is not reported as frequently by patients as it is by clinicians, but more so on behalf of children.
